Mnemonics for CYP450 Drugs: Inducers (ASMR): Anticonvulsants, St John Warts, Modafinil, Rifampin Inhibitors (ABCDE): Antimicrobials (lots), Belly (Omeprazol, Cimetidine), Cardio (Amiodarone, Calcium channel blockers), Depression (SSRIs), Extra (Grapefruit juice)

Disclaimers / Corrections: I came up with this list through my personal experience: having answered around 15.000 questions from more than 5 qbanks + experience with the real deal, so it's not like any official list taken from the USMLE. I'll be adding in this comment any other extremely high yield topic I didn't think off while making this list: 1. In 30:07 it was supposed to say Cherry Red MACULA: NOT HEMANGIOMA. 2. For Immunology: CGD is also a very high yield primary immunodeficiency 3. In cardio: other High Yield ECGs: WPW and Hyperkalemia 4. Most of embryology is included in the other systems (example neonatal ARDS)... I’d just add pharyngeal pouches/arches, and embryological origins (Ex. They give you an adrenal insufficiency case and ask from which embryological layer or structure are the adrenals derived)
